«arrays» 태그된 질문

배열은 각각 하나 이상의 인덱스로 식별되는 요소 (값, 변수 또는 참조) 모음으로 구성된 정렬 된 선형 데이터 구조입니다. 배열의 특정 변형에 대해 질문 할 때는 [vector], [arraylist], [matrix]와 같은 관련 태그를 대신 사용하십시오. 이 태그를 사용할 때 프로그래밍 언어와 관련된 질문에서 사용중인 프로그래밍 언어로 질문에 태그를 지정하십시오.

9
두 배열의 내용이 동일한 지 (순서에 관계없이) 확인
Rails 1.2.3과 함께 Ruby 1.8.6을 사용하고 있으며 두 배열이 동일한 순서인지 여부에 관계없이 동일한 요소를 가지고 있는지 확인해야합니다. 배열 중 하나는 중복을 포함하지 않도록 보장됩니다 (다른 하나는 대답이 아니오 인 경우). 내 첫 생각은 require 'set' a.to_set == b.to_set 하지만 더 효율적이거나 관용적 인 방법이 있는지 궁금합니다.

11
Android에서 JSON 배열 (Json 개체 아님)을 구문 분석하는 방법
JSONArray를 구문 분석하는 방법을 찾는 데 문제가 있습니다. 다음과 같이 보입니다. [{"name":"name1","url":"url1"},{"name":"name2","url":"url2"},...] JSON이 다르게 작성된 경우 구문 분석하는 방법을 알고 있습니다 (즉, 객체 배열 대신 json 객체가 반환 된 경우). 그러나 그것은 내가 가진 전부이고 그것과 함께 가야합니다. * 편집 : 유효한 json입니다. 이 json을 사용하여 iPhone 앱을 만들었습니다. 이제 …
90 java  android  json  gson  arrays 



4
ES6에서 노드 목록 필터링 또는 매핑
ES6에서 노드 목록을 필터링하거나 매핑하는 가장 효율적인 방법은 무엇입니까? 내 측정 값에 따라 다음 옵션 중 하나를 사용합니다. [...nodelist].filter 또는 Array.from(nodelist).filter 어느 것을 추천 하시겠습니까? 예를 들어 어레이를 사용하지 않는 더 좋은 방법이 있습니까?


7
Rails가 jQuery에서 JSON을 올바르게 디코딩하지 않음 (정수 키가있는 해시가되는 배열)
jQuery를 사용하여 JSON 객체 배열을 Rails에 게시 할 때마다이 문제가 발생합니다. 배열을 문자열 화하면 jQuery가 올바르게 작동하고 있음을 알 수 있습니다. "shared_items"=>"[{\"entity_id\":\"253\",\"position\":1},{\"entity_id\":\"823\",\"position\":2}]" 그러나 배열을 AJAX 호출의 데이터로 보내면 다음과 같이 표시됩니다. "shared_items"=>{"0"=>{"entity_id"=>"253", "position"=>"1"}, "1"=>{"entity_id"=>"823", "position"=>"2"}} 일반 배열을 보내면 작동합니다. "shared_items"=>["entity_253"] Rails가 배열을 이상한 해시로 변경하는 이유는 무엇입니까? 떠오르는 유일한 이유는 …

12
C ++에서 문자열 배열을 선언하는 방법은 무엇입니까?
가능한 최선의 방법으로 정적 문자열 배열의 모든 요소를 ​​반복하려고합니다. 한 줄에 선언하고 번호를 추적하지 않고도 요소를 쉽게 추가 / 제거 할 수 있기를 원합니다. 정말 간단하게 들리지 않습니까? 가능한 비 해결 방법 : vector<string> v; v.push_back("abc"); b.push_back("xyz"); for(int i = 0; i < v.size(); i++) cout << v[i] << endl; …
89 c++  arrays 

2
bash 완료 컨텍스트에서 $ {array [*]}와 $ {array [@]}에 대한 혼동
나는 처음으로 bash 완성을 작성하는 데 찌르고 있으며 bash 배열 ( ${array[@]}및 ${array[*]}) 을 역 참조하는 두 가지 방법에 대해 약간 혼란 스럽습니다 . 다음은 관련 코드 덩어리입니다 (그런데 작동하지만 더 잘 이해하고 싶습니다). _switch() { local cur perls local ROOT=${PERLBREW_ROOT:-$HOME/perl5/perlbrew} COMPREPLY=() cur=${COMP_WORDS[COMP_CWORD]} perls=($ROOT/perls/perl-*) # remove all but the final …

7
배열에서 인덱스 또는 키를 확인하는 가장 쉬운 방법은 무엇입니까?
사용 : set -o nounset 다음과 같은 인덱스 배열이 있습니다. myArray=( "red" "black" "blue" ) 요소 1이 설정되었는지 확인하는 가장 짧은 방법은 무엇입니까? 나는 때때로 다음을 사용합니다. test "${#myArray[@]}" -gt "1" && echo "1 exists" || echo "1 doesn't exist" 선호하는 것이 있는지 알고 싶습니다. 비 연속 인덱스를 처리하는 방법은 …
89 arrays  bash  indexing  key 

11
배열의 인덱스가 존재합니까
나는 직장에서 정말 나쁜 냄새가 나는 코드를 물려 받았습니다. 가능한 가장 고통스럽지 않은 해결책을 찾고 싶습니다. 임의의 숫자가 배열에서 유효한 요소인지 확인하는 방법이 있습니까? 예-array [25]가 있는지 확인해야합니다. 바람직하게는 행을 찾기 위해 배열을 통해 foreach ()를 수행하지 않고이 작업을 수행하는 것이 좋습니다. 이 작업을 수행하는 방법이 있습니까, 아니면 foreach 루프가 …
89 c#  arrays  indexing 

12
Swift에서 배열 요소별로 그룹화하는 방법
이 코드가 있다고 가정 해 봅시다. class Stat { var statEvents : [StatEvents] = [] } struct StatEvents { var name: String var date: String var hours: Int } var currentStat = Stat() currentStat.statEvents = [ StatEvents(name: "lunch", date: "01-01-2015", hours: 1), StatEvents(name: "dinner", date: "01-01-2015", hours: 1), StatEvents(name: "dinner", …
89 ios  arrays  swift  nsarray 



10
배열을 C의 함수에 인수로 전달
배열을 인수로 포함하는 함수를 작성하고 다음과 같이 배열의 값을 전달하여 호출합니다. void arraytest(int a[]) { // changed the array a a[0]=a[0]+a[1]; a[1]=a[0]-a[1]; a[0]=a[0]-a[1]; } void main() { int arr[]={1,2}; printf("%d \t %d",arr[0],arr[1]); arraytest(arr); printf("\n After calling fun arr contains: %d\t %d",arr[0],arr[1]); } 내가 찾은 것은 arraytest()값을 전달하여 함수를 호출하고 있지만 …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.